Makin Waves Song of the Week: "You’re Not Here" by Jonathan Tea


By Bob Makin

originally published: 10/20/2023


Asbury Park singer-songwriter Jonathan Tea’s latest single, “You’re Not Here,” is the Makin Waves Song of the Week. ART BY JONATHAN TEA

In the midst of relaunching his Spilling the Tea songwriters night, Jonathan Tea is balancing his busy “y’allternative” band, Hooper, with the release of his new completely solo single, “You’re Not Here.”

Not only did the Asbury Park singer-songwriter write, perform, record and mix the tongue-in-cheek heartbreaker, he also photographed and designed its artwork.

Talk about Makin Waves, hence, “You’re Not Here” is the Makin Waves Song of the Week.

“I wrote it kind of tongue in cheek about a guy who is completely heartbroken, but putting on a front that he’s totally OK,” Jonathan said. “I originally had planned to have that guitar solo be on a juiced-up Les Paul, but when the idea of the baritone guitar popped in my head, I tried it and it just worked. I came up with a simple Spaghetti Western-style melody and threw a bunch of reverb and delay on it. I feel like it opens up this beautiful space in the middle of the track. I’ve always loved that twangy baritone guitar sound, and I’m happy it found a place in ‘You’re Not Here.’”

Mastered by Frank Gagliardi at The Fuselage in Nashville, the single will be followed by an LP that soon will be recorded at Lakehouse Studios in Asbury Park for a spring release.

You can get a taste of those songs live at the next Spilling the Tea on Nov. 5 at John’s Cracker Barrel in the Shark River Hills section of Neptune. Jonathan will share the stage with Nashville singer-songwriter Lucy Isabel.

“I feature a different songwriter each month, and we take turns trading songs and the stories behind them,” he said. “I had to shut it down during the pandemic, so it’s good to be back. That happens on the first Thursday of each month at John’s Cracker Barrel.”

As the keyboardist in Hooper, Jonathan also will play Nov. 11 at Albert Hall in the Waretown section of Ocean Township. For more, check out his Instagram here.
